What used to go on in Japan after dark? Illegal street racing for the most part, though it wasn't as dodgy as it sounds As Japan's automotive industry began to flourish in the 1960s and produce sporty cars, Japanese enthusiasts took to the country's stunning mountain roads to race one another, often in highly modified machinery - and driving in such a fashion grew in popularity and spread to urban expressways.
